Where is Breaffy House Hotel and Spa, Castlebar?

Where is Breaffy House Hotel and Spa, Castlebar located?

Breaffy House Hotel and Spa, Castlebar, Breaffy House Hotel and Spa, Castlebar, Irish (approx. 53.84369°, -9.23888°)


Where is Breaffy House Hotel and Spa, Castlebar on the map?